Casa de las Campanas
The Casa de las Campanas is one of the three oldest buildings in the city of Pontevedra in Spain, and perhaps the oldest civil building. It is located in Don Filiberto street, at number 11, in the old town.Photo: Pvibahu, CC BY-SA 4.0.

A Moureira
Quarter
Photo: juantiagues, CC BY-SA 2.0.
A Moureira is the old seafarers' and fishermen's quarter of the city of Pontevedra, where the Seamen's Guild lived, near the Lérez river, the Pontevedra ria and the Gafos river. Nowadays, it is part of the city centre.

O Burgo
Suburb
Photo: Gerardo nuñez, CC BY 3.0.
O Burgo is a neighbourhood in the city of Pontevedra. It is one of the oldest neighbourhoods in the city and is crossed by the Portuguese Way. On its right-hand side is the A Xunqueira area with important educational and cultural facilities.
